Step 4: Understand the Wagering
This is where most people lose. A free £5 no deposit casino 2026 uk claim today usually has a 30x to 40x wagering requirement. That means you need to wager £150 to £200 before you can withdraw. Some casinos offer 20x, which is better. 888 Casino sometimes has 25x. PlayOJO is famous for no wagering on free spins, but for free cash, they still have terms. Check the expiry too. Some give you 72 hours. Others give you 7 days.

Terms and Conditions: The Boring But Necessary Part
I hate writing this section. You hate reading it. But I’ve seen too many people cry about losing their bonus because they didn’t check the rules. So here’s a quick breakdown of what you need to look for in a free £5 no deposit casino 2026 uk claim today offer.
- Wagering Requirement: Usually 30x to 40x. Anything above 40x is a joke. Avoid it.
- Max Cashout: Usually £100 to £150. If it’s £50 or less, it’s not worth your time.
- Expiry: 72 hours is common. Some give 7 days. Use it or lose it.
- Game Restrictions: Most free £5 bonuses are for slots only. Some exclude table games or live casino. Check the list.
- Bonus Code: Some require a code like ‘UK2026’ or ‘FIVE2026’. Enter it during registration or deposit.
- Payment Method: You might need to add a debit card or PayPal before you can withdraw. This is standard for KYC.
